Your first taekwondo class at Park's Taekwondo Academy

Nervous about walking into a taekwondo school for the first time? Almost everyone is, and good instructors expect beginners to come through the door. Here's what to know. What to expect: a typical first class is a warm-up, then drilling basic stances, blocks, and kicks with a partner or on pads — not hard sparring. Rest whenever you need to; no one will bat an eye. What to wear: loose athletic wear you can move in (or a dobok if you have one); you'll train barefoot on the floor. What to bring: water and a positive attitude — many schools lend a loaner dobok for a first class, so it's worth asking when you call. As you keep training you'll get your own dobok and belt, and sparring gear (mouthguard, headgear, and guards) once you begin sparring. Sparring eases in gradually, once your fundamentals and forms are solid. Arrive 10–15 minutes early to sign a waiver and meet the instructor. It gets easier fast — most people feel far more at home by their third class.

Taekwondo is a martial art and a contact sport. Ease in, listen to your instructors, and if you have any injuries or health concerns, mention them before class and check with a doctor if you're unsure.
